ERBIL (Kurdistan24) – "President Barzani does not only represent the Kurdish people during his visit to Baghdad, but he represents all Iraqis in resolving the problems facing the Iraqi political process," said Dr. Chwas Hassan, an advisor to the Kurdistan Parliament.

Dr. Hassan, an academic and advisor, highlighted the significant role of the Kurds in Iraq's political landscape, stating, “The Kurds have had a major role in Iraq since the 1960s and 1980s during the revolution and in the mountains. This role has shaped the political map of the Kurdistan Region, continuing since the era of Mulla Mustafa Barzani.”

He added, "After the 2003 Iraqi Freedom War, the influence of the Kurds and President Barzani in reorganizing and establishing a new Iraq has been prominent regionally and internationally. Iraq now needs to reorganize itself due to internal conflicts and regional and external hegemony, as it is in a precarious situation."

Hassan pointed out that the issues in Iraq are twofold: "The first set of problems are current and partly related to the Sunnis, and the conflicts between the Kurdistan Region and Iraq. The creation of a new Iraq based on partnership, agreement, and balance has not been fully implemented."

"This visit by President Barzani marks a new phase in reorganizing Iraq and addressing its political crisis. Iraq has faced persistent problems for the past decade, particularly since 2014. Beyond the war against terrorism and ISIS, the rights of Kurds, Sunnis, and other groups in Iraq have reached an impasse. The 2019 Shiite demonstrations indicate that the political process and governance in Iraq require a comprehensive review," he continued.

He emphasized, "President Barzani has played two crucial roles since the beginning: leading the revolution to achieve the legitimate rights of the Kurdish people and striving to establish democracy in Iraq. His wisdom, precision, and farsightedness in identifying and solving problems make him a fair and effective leader. President Barzani is now playing a pivotal role in addressing the issues facing all Iraqi sects within the political process."
